The concert 'Music of the Birds' at the Jordan Schnitzer Japanese Arts Learning Center combined the talents of flutist Amelia Lukas and pianist Yoko Greeney, celebrating the 65-year partnership between Portland and Sapporo. With compositions inspired by both Japanese and Oregonian themes, the event was a collaborative effort with the Bird Alliance of Oregon. Attendees were treated to musical reflections and insightful commentary, weaving together the beauty of music and the crucial connection to nature and bird conservation, particularly highlighting local avian species and their significance.
